How they compare

Cape Verde currently reports 6.95 million current LCU per square kilometre against 6.90 million current LCU per square kilometre in Guinea-Bissau, a difference of 41,310 current LCU per square kilometre.

Across all 44 years both countries report, Cape Verde has been ahead every year.

Cape Verde ranks 77th and Guinea-Bissau ranks 78th of 205 countries.

Cape Verde has averaged higher in every one of the 5 decades both report.
